Step-by-Step Instructions for Watermelon Shaved Ice
- Begin by cutting a ripe watermelon into tall, baton-shaped pieces, about 2 inches thick. Freeze on a lined baking sheet for at least 4 hours.
- Remove the frozen watermelon from the freezer and shave using a microplane into fine strands directly into a small bowl.
- Squeeze fresh lime juice generously over the top of the shaved watermelon, drizzle with honey, and sprinkle flaky salt.
- Garnish with fresh basil leaves and serve immediately to enjoy the ideal icy texture.

Notes
For best results, shave watermelon just before serving. Chilling bowls helps keep the dessert cold longer. Experiment with unique toppings to find your favorite flavor combination.
